Eligibility

In general, a person is eligible for regular membership if they attended and received a certificate from Kings' College Budo. They are also eligible if they are, or have been:

- a spouse of a member of BI.
- a member of the faculty at Kings' College Budo.
- a faculty member or officer at the College.
- a member of any Board or Committee of the College.
- a student in good standing at the College for at least one full academic year.

This Fund was used to establish a scholarship program for deserving students at King’s College Budo, which began in September of 2003. Already, Ruth Mulungi, our first beneficiary completed her A level education at Budo. Her success looms as an exciting testimony to BI’s commitment to changing King’s College Budo (one life at a time if necessary) through the generous support of our donors.

Ruth Mulungi (2003-2005)
Ruth was our first sponsee and surely she was a gem at King's College Budo. Her mother was met with hard financial strife and we managed to fund her tuition through Advanced Level of education at KCB.
Currently, Ruth is successfully pursuing a Business Degree in Procurement and Supplies Management at Uganda's Premier University, Makerere University Business School. She is eternally thankful for all of your donations that helped to jump-start her dreams.


Maureen Mukhoda
(2006-2007)
Maureen was an outstanding student while still at King's College Budo. She participated in everything from drama in Sabaganzi House to leadership (she was a House Prefect). The list goes on but a picture is worth a thousand words, so have a look at her accomplishments in our album below.

Eseza Kiwumulo (2008 - 2011)
We are currently sponsoring our third student , Eseza Kiwumulo. She currently needs Ug Shs 570 000 per term for her tuition and board. We are in the process of acquiring some photos of Eseza.

About Us



Budonians International (BI) is an organization made up of well-wishers of King's College Budo uniting to support the under-previledged students at the hill. Launched in February 2002, BI set out to create an avenue for Budonians (aspora and diaspora) to pull intellectual and financial resources together and help each other leverage our individual talents and visions, in order to create more of what is good - both for ourselves and for others.


BI has 3 simple goals:

:: to support underprivileged students at King ’s College Budo.
:: to improve and modernize King’s College Budo through philanthropy.
:: to connect highly motivated and excellent students to international universities abroad (US/UK)

We believe that given the chance, Budonians could exceed the highest international standards of education.
